Tips for Creating Engaging Long-Form Content
Now that we’ve covered the basics, let’s move on to some tips for creating engaging long-form content on TikTok:
- Plan Ahead: Before creating your content, plan your storyline, theme, and target audience. This will help you stay focused and ensure your content resonates with your audience.
- Use High-Quality Equipment: Invest in good quality microphones, lights, and cameras to ensure your content looks and sounds professional.
- Be Authentic: Be true to yourself and your brand. Authenticity is key to building a loyal following on TikTok.
- Engage with Your Audience: Interact with your followers by responding to comments, answering questions, and using Hashtags to reach a wider audience.
Creating a Long-Form Content Strategy
A well-planned content strategy is crucial for success on TikTok. Here are some tips to help you create a long-form content strategy:
- Identify Your Niche: Determine what type of content you want to create and what your target audience is interested in.
- Develop a Content Calendar: Plan and schedule your content in advance using a content calendar. This will help you stay organized and ensure consistency.
- Use Hashtags: Research and use relevant Hashtags to increase your content’s discoverability and reach a wider audience.
- Collaborate with Other Creators: Partner with other TikTok creators to reach new audiences and build relationships within the community.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Here are some common mistakes to avoid when creating long-form content on TikTok:
- Lack of Planning: Failing to plan your content in advance can lead to a lack of focus and a disjointed narrative.
- Poor Quality Equipment: Using low-quality equipment can result in a poor viewing experience and a lack of engagement.
- Not Engaging with Your Audience: Failing to interact with your audience can lead to a lack of engagement and a disconnection from your followers.
- Not Using Hashtags: Failing to use relevant Hashtags can result in a lack of discoverability and reach a wider audience.
